Business Day Location definition

Business Day Location means each of the locations specified as such in the Schedule.

Examples of Business Day Location in a sentence

  • Further Definitions applicable to the Securities Settlement Currency EURBusiness Day A day on which the Trans-European Automated Real-time GrossSettlement Express Transfer (TARGET2) system (or any successor thereto) is open, on which commercial banks and foreign exchange markets settle payments in the Business Day Location specified in the Product Terms and on which each relevant Clearing Agent settles payments.

  • Delivery Business Day: Means, in respect of an Emissions Allowance Transaction, anyday, which is not a Saturday or Sunday, on which commercial banks are open for general business in both Delivering Party's Delivery Business Day Location and the Receiving Party's Delivery Business Day Location.
